The combination of unripe tomatoes, a coating of seasoned breadcrumbs or cornmeal, and the application of heat results in a specific dish. This culinary preparation offers an alternative to traditional methods by utilizing an oven rather than a frying pan. This process aims to reduce the amount of oil typically associated with the conventional version.
Preparing this dish in an oven offers several advantages. It can lower the overall fat content, potentially making it a healthier option. Baking may also simplify the cooking process, requiring less hands-on attention compared to stovetop frying.
